"14 days at Broncemar"
We enjoyed 14 fantastic days at Broncemar from 22 July to 5 August. The hotel kindly gave us our favorite room, which made us very happy. This was our first visit to Broncemar in the summer, and we found the apartment can get quite hot. The ceiling fan alone isn’t enough to cool it down when the sun has baked the apartment all day. We ended up buying an extra fan to get a comfortable night’s sleep. It’s worth noting that in winter, the fan works perfectly, but for summer stays, the hotel might consider installing air conditioning to make things more comfortable. Overall, a lovely stay in a wonderful hotel!

"Great time. Don’t listen to miserable reviews"
Before our holiday, my mum read a lot of negative reviews online, which nearly put her off the trip. Many complained about things like cockroaches, lack of air conditioning, and other minor issues. Having returned to the UK, I can honestly say most of these comments are rubbish. Some people just love to complain! Yes, there are cockroaches around the grounds, but we stayed in a ground-floor room and didn’t see a single one inside. Perhaps food left on floors attracts them, but for us, it wasn’t an issue. Regarding air conditioning, the hotel clearly states they only provide fans, so anyone expecting AC should note this. It was a little warm when using the hairdryer, but nothing unbearable. Our room was lovely, with a beautiful terrace, and the people we met were wonderful. My son made plenty of friends, and we all had a fantastic time. The only minor note is that you do need to get your towels on a sun lounger before 9am. On our first day, arriving at 10:30am meant every sunbed was taken—but that’s hardly a complaint! Overall, this hotel is great, and I would 100% return. Don’t let negative comments put you off a brilliant holiday experience!

"Decent, but some improvements needed"
Our first impression wasn’t ideal, as it took over 45 minutes to check in due to a very slow receptionist. The rooms were spacious and generally clean. On one occasion, the cleaner forgot to leave towels, but reception quickly resolved the issue. There’s no air conditioning, but the large ceiling fan did the job. The showers are poorly designed, with water leaking onto the floor, so towels are needed to catch it. The hotel has two good-sized pools, a kids’ pool, and a splash area. Sunbeds require an early morning dash, but that’s typical for most resorts. Being under the flight path, planes fly overhead frequently, though it wasn’t a major issue for us. We did see a few cockroaches, including a couple in our room, but not enough to consider the hotel infested. Kids’ club was basic but functional. The food was decent, though a little repetitive, and poolside snacks were mediocre. The entertainment team worked hard and did a good job, but nighttime music was excessively loud for a family hotel, especially for rooms near the stage. Overall, a reasonably priced hotel with some drawbacks. Some negative reviews seem over the top, but in my opinion, it’s closer to a 3-star experience than 4.

"A good hotel"
We had a great stay at the hotel. The accommodation isn’t air-conditioned, but it wasn’t too hot thanks to the breezy location and a ceiling fan in the room. The bedding was very comfortable, and the meals were of good quality, with breakfast offering a nice variety. Meal times were a little late (breakfast from 8am), but it wasn’t an issue for us. The hotel was generally clean, though housekeeping could be a bit “sloppy” at times. The pools were clean, not crowded, and accessible until 6pm—just remember to bring clips to secure your towels to the deckchairs. The location is very convenient, with a nearby beach, shops, and bars. The supermarket, restaurants, and even cheap tobacco were all within easy reach. The bus station is just a 3-minute walk, and taxis are 1 minute away. The entertainment team was very friendly, though sometimes short-staffed. Evening entertainment was entertaining but nothing extraordinary. All-inclusive drinks are available from 10am to 11pm. One minor downside: if your accommodation overlooks the pools, it can be a bit noisy, with the regular passage of planes overhead. Overall, a comfortable and enjoyable stay.
"Bug hotel"
We stayed with my daughter, her partner, and our grandchildren. The pools are great, but you need to be up by 6:30 am to secure sunbeds. Breakfast was okay, but bar food was very poor – ham and cheese toasties were the only decent option. I stayed in a single or couples’ room, which was spacious with a massive TV showing English channels, a rain shower, and a roll-top bath. Towels were changed daily, bins emptied, and the room was fully cleaned once during our 7-day stay. The entertainment team were very nice and worked hard. Unfortunately, the hotel has a serious cockroach problem. They were everywhere. My daughter repeatedly woke up with them crawling on her in bed and saw them in the shower, on walls, and the floor. Maintenance tried multiple times with sprays and cleaning, but she only had two nights without them. At night, cockroaches could be seen all over the pathways. Overall, while the pools and staff were enjoyable, the infestation makes it very difficult to recommend this hotel.
